Avatar billede jemagnussen Nybegynder
24. juni 2004 - 07:06 Der er 5 kommentarer og
1 løsning

Undgå opdatering af dato.

Hej,

Jeg bruger et excel 2000 regneark som formular til indtastning af indkøbsordrer, arket åbnes som skrivebeskyttet og gemmes hver gang under nyt navn. Jeg vil gerne have dags dato indsat automatisk ved åbning og det er ikke noget problem i formularen (=TODAY()). det jeg gerne vil undgå er at datoen bliver opdateret hver gang jeg søger i gamle gemte indkøbsordrer.
Er det muligt ved hjælp af VBA at fjerne formlen =TODAY() og lade værdien blive i den gemte kopi.
Jeg kunne godt overbevise bruger om at bruge ^+(;) til at indsætte datoen, men problemet bliver det samme, der indsættes aktuelle dato ved åbning af filen senere... :-(

På forhånd tak...

jemagnussen
Avatar billede bak Seniormester
24. juni 2004 - 08:33 #1
Det lyder mærkeligt. hvis du bruger ctrl-shift-; skulle datoen ikke kunne ændre sig.

Denne sub kan nok bruges.
Den skal indsættes i modulet ThisWorkBook.
Du skal selv andræ arknavn og celle.
Cellen opdateres med dags dato, hvis den er tom ellers sker der ikke noget

Private Sub Workbook_Open()
    With Sheets("Ark1")
    If IsEmpty(Range("A1")) Then Range("A1") = Date
    End With
End Sub
Avatar billede bak Seniormester
24. juni 2004 - 08:33 #2
andræ = ændre
Avatar billede jemagnussen Nybegynder
24. juni 2004 - 08:51 #3
Hej bak,

Tak for hurtigt svar, du har selvfølgeligt ret, når der bruges ctrl-shift-; ændres datoen ikke. Sub'en virker fint :-) tak for det.

Mvh

Jesper

PS: Hvordan giver jeg dig dine points...?
Avatar billede bak Seniormester
24. juni 2004 - 08:55 #4
du kan give point nu :-)
Avatar billede bak Seniormester
24. juni 2004 - 08:57 #5
Lige en lille rettelse
Private Sub Workbook_Open()
    With Sheets("Ark1")
    If IsEmpty(.Range("A1")) Then .Range("A1") = Date
    End With
End Sub

Der er sat et par punktummer ind i midterste linie
Avatar billede jemagnussen Nybegynder
25. juni 2004 - 05:11 #6
Undskyld Bak,

Jeg har trykket på Accepter een gang, men kan se at du endnu ikke har fået dine points...? Jeg prøver igen...

Mvh

Jesper
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i har et stort udvalg af Excel kurser. Find lige det kursus der passer dig lige her.

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ester



IT-JOB